The Morpheus screen is a versatile laboratory tool used for crystallization screening. It provides a standardized approach to exploring a wide range of crystallization conditions, facilitating the optimization of protein crystal growth.

The JCSG-plus is a crystallization screening kit developed by the Joint Center for Structural Genomics (JCSG). It contains a diverse set of 96 chemical conditions designed to facilitate the initial screening of proteins for crystallization.

LithoLoops are a set of precision-engineered loops for protein crystallization. They are designed to facilitate the handling and transfer of protein solutions during the crystallization process. LithoLoops are made of high-quality materials and feature a consistent loop size and shape to ensure reliable and reproducible results.

The JCSG+ screen is a crystallization screening kit designed to identify initial crystallization conditions for protein targets. It contains a pre-formulated set of 96 unique chemical conditions that have been optimized to facilitate the crystallization of a wide range of macromolecules.

MemGold is a screening kit designed to facilitate the crystallization of membrane proteins. It contains a set of optimized solutions that can be used to search for suitable crystallization conditions for a wide range of membrane proteins.

MRC crystallization plates are a type of laboratory equipment used for the crystallization of proteins and other macromolecules. These plates provide a standardized platform for setting up multiple crystallization experiments simultaneously, enabling the efficient screening of various conditions to optimize crystal growth.
